If you have actually been injured in a cars and truck mishap while you are at work, after that you exist an extremely special legal scenario. If you remained in the performance of your work duties, and you are injured in a motor lorry mishap in the performance of those obligations, you may have both a worker's settlement insurance claim a third-party liability claim.
Under Virginia legislation, if you're hurt on the work, you may be qualified to workers' compensation benefits. If you're involved in a motor vehicle mishap while simply travelling to or from job, you're usually not covered.
Seeking an employees' compensation case can protect you the needed healthcare and wage advantages immediately. A third-party responsibility claim stands out from employees' payment. It includes holding the party in charge of the accident liable for his or her oversight. A third-party responsibility insurance claim means that if another person's activities triggered your accident while you went to work, you can hold that individual in charge of your injuries.
If you're found partly liable for a crash, you can not recoup in an injury claim. The key distinction is that in employees' settlement insurance claims, oversight is not a factor in all. Whether you or another person was at fault for your injury, you still have a valid employees' settlement claim.

When you're included in a car accident or vehicle accident and have a workers' compensation case, it's essential to keep in mind that employees' compensation has a lien on your accident case. This implies the workers' compensation insurance coverage carrier is qualified to a proportional share of their repayments. Resolving a third-party vehicle crash instance without thinking about the employees' compensation lien can have lawful effects.

If the employer is self-insured, the situation usually will go via a workers payment division within the firm or be sent out to an outside company that takes care of workers compensation insurance claims. Michigan is a compulsory insurance policy state. All employers need to offer employees compensation insurance via a state accepted provider. The employer might choose to be approved by the state agency to be a self-insurer or an individual in a team self-insurers' organization.
Special arrangements may be accepted for significant building projects to enable for single protection of all staff members on a particular website. Injuries should arise out of and throughout employment at a job website. If a worker is hurt as the outcome of willful and unyielding misbehavior, they are not qualified to advantages.
Employees traveling to and from job are not covered. If a worker's work needs travel, or if the employee is on an unique mission, he/she is covered while traveling. If a damaged worker or the insurance provider contests the claim, it goes to the Employees Special Needs Settlement Company for resolution.
The WDCA tries to aid both celebrations get to a resolution and Nolish says that occurs the majority of the time. If the facilitation procedure does not fix the matter, or the worker has an attorney, the situation is referred to a magistrate, that serves as the court. Workers payment instances in Michigan are bench tests.
Michigan is a wage-loss compensation instance state. Not only do you have to verify that the injury developed out of and was in the training course of work, yet as an outcome of that injury, you are losing wages. The magistrate makes the final choice on the issue. There is no court in an employees compensation instance.

Wage loss advantages start after the hurt employee misses out on at the very least 7 days. Sherman Oaks Lawyers Workers Comp. If the injury stops a staff member from functioning for even more than seven days, payment advantages begin on the 8th day. If the injury continues beyond 2 weeks, the injured worker will receive wage loss settlement for the first week of handicap
It is not taken into consideration late up until the 30th day following an injury. Advantages can be paid as long as the employee is disabled, perhaps meaning for the rest of their life, but can be reduced up to 50% after age 65 or upon receipt of Social Safety and security benefits. Benefits may likewise be decreased by various other employer funded benefits such as sick pay, retired life pensions or disability benefits.
Weekly wage loss advantages are determined based upon the hurt employees average wage for the highest possible 32 weeks of the previous 52 weeks. The benefit price is 80% of the after-tax value of their ordinary once a week wage. The maximum amount of wage-loss benefits a worker can receive is 90% of the average weekly wage (AWW) from the previous year.

Workers are entitled to have all practical and needed treatment spent for by their company or the employer's insurance policy service provider. The list of solutions that need to be paid consist of: Medical Surgical Hospital Dental Nursing treatment Chiropractic treatment Medical advantages likewise include drugs and home appliances such as dental braces, props, canes, prosthesis, mobility devices and fitting out vans or home to be handicap obtainable.
Sometimes, the employer might have to alter workstations to fit an injury or ask the employee to do a different work entirely. There are training programs assist injured employees in finding out new jobs. The Vocational Recovery for Injured Worker is created to provide therapy, advice, retraining and task placement aid.
